Which type of CPU cooler contains heat pipes?

Most commonly, tower-style CPU coolers and some high-performance air coolers contain heat pipes. These heat pipes transfer heat away from the CPU to the cooling fins, where it is dissipated.

If you have a CPU that gets very hot and will be used in a noisy industrial building what effect would these conditions have on your choice of coolers?

I would not be concerned with the volume of the cooling fan, go with something cheap and reliable rather than quiet and expensive (although quiet often means more reliable) Personally, in a noisy building, a CPU cooler's noise level is not something I would worry about. I would get a cooler that produces the most air flow to keep the CPU cool. A fan that moves the most volume of air along with the best coils and heatsink would be the best choice. I doubt you would even hear the loudest cooler there is.
